Setting Google as Homepage using Google Chrome

To set Google as your homepage in Google Chrome, follow these simple steps:

Browser Type Steps to Set Homepage Tips for Success
Google Chrome
  • Open Google Chrome and click on the three vertical dots in the top right corner of the browser window.
  • From the dropdown menu, select “Settings.”
  • In the settings page, scroll down to the “Appearance” section and click on the “Change” button next to “Homepage and new tab.”
  • Type https://www.google.com in the text field and click on “Done.”
Make sure to select the correct URL for Google’s homepage, which is https://www.google.com.

Safari
  • Open Safari and click on “Safari” in the top menu bar.
  • From the dropdown menu, select “Preferences.”
  • In the preferences window, click on “General” in the left-hand menu and enter https://www.google.com in the URL field for “Homepage.”
  • Click “Close” to save your changes.
Make sure to enter the correct URL for Google’s homepage, which is https://www.google.com.

Browser Extensions

Browser extensions can interfere with your ability to set Google as your homepage. Some extensions may change your homepage settings or block access to Google. To troubleshoot browser extensions, you can try the following:

  • Check if any extension is blocking Google. Look for extensions that may be interfering with your ability to access Google, such as ad blockers or malware scanners.
  • Disable any extensions that may be causing the issue. Try disabling all extensions and then retry setting Google as your homepage.

Browser Settings

Browser settings can also cause issues when trying to set Google as your homepage. To troubleshoot browser settings, you can try the following:

  • Check if your browser is set to use a different homepage. Look for settings that may be overriding your homepage preferences.
  • Reset your browser to its default settings. This will erase all custom settings and preferences, so be sure to note any important settings before resetting your browser.
